Output 59a4630a1ad7ec58d0d91d24a04595ebdb71b15fbfd396945a9ed6cd0416ef88:4

value
132406
script pubkey
OP_0 OP_PUSHBYTES_20 3d1f28e74f0f0f4fbd764738c17958456072635b
address
bc1q850j3e60pu85l0tkguuvz72cg4s8yc6mtfkjpv
transaction
59a4630a1ad7ec58d0d91d24a04595ebdb71b15fbfd396945a9ed6cd0416ef88
confirmations
181975
spent
true